Panoramic Lookout

Panoramic Lookout

Summit

Breathtaking views of the Spencer Gorge, surrounding towns, and the Niagara Escarpment. A photographer's dream!

Instagram+1
Tews Falls

Tews Falls

Spencer Gorge Conservation Area

Witness the tallest waterfall in Hamilton, cascading dramatically within the gorge. Access may be restricted at times.

InstagramReddit
Webster Falls

Webster Falls

Spencer Gorge Conservation Area

Another stunning waterfall within the conservation area, offering beautiful scenery and a rewarding hike.

Frequently Asked Questions

🚇 🗺️ Getting There

Dundas Peak is about an hour's drive from Toronto. You can drive directly to the Spencer Gorge Conservation Area parking lot. Public transport options are limited and would involve multiple transfers, making a car the most convenient option. Instagram+1

Yes, paid parking is available at the Spencer Gorge Conservation Area. It's recommended to arrive early, especially during peak season, as spots can fill up quickly. Instagram

While possible, it's challenging. You would likely need to take a GO Train to Hamilton and then a local bus, followed by a significant walk or taxi. Having a car is highly recommended for ease of access. Instagram

Dundas Peak is located within the Spencer Gorge Conservation Area. The address is typically associated with the parking area for the trails leading to the peak and waterfalls. Use GPS navigation to 'Spencer Gorge Conservation Area' or 'Dundas Peak Parking'. TikTok

Public transport to Dundas Peak is not straightforward. It typically involves taking a GO Train to Hamilton and then a local bus route that may still require a considerable walk to the trailhead. Instagram

The Magic of Fall at Dundas Peak

Dundas Peak is renowned for its spectacular autumn display. During late September and early October, the surrounding forests transform into a vibrant tapestry of reds, oranges, and yellows. This makes it one of the most sought-after fall hiking destinations near Toronto. The panoramic views from the peak are amplified by the colorful canopy, creating a truly breathtaking scene. Many visitors specifically plan their trips around this time to witness the seasonal beauty. TikTokInstagram+1

To experience the fall colors at their best, aim for mid-October, though late September is also prime time. Be prepared for crowds during this period, as the stunning foliage draws many visitors. The Spencer Gorge Conservation Area, which includes Dundas Peak, Tews Falls, and Webster Falls, offers a complete autumn nature experience. Remember that reservations are often required, especially on weekends, so plan accordingly to avoid disappointment. TikTokReddit

Beyond the peak itself, the trails winding through the gorge offer intimate views of the changing leaves. The crisp autumn air and the rustling of leaves underfoot add to the sensory experience. It’s a perfect escape for a weekend getaway to immerse yourself in nature's vibrant farewell to summer. TikTokInstagram
